Hi, this is a dup to bug 1677398. The TL;DR is that in some guest description libvirt doesn't know (at the right time and place) what the device will be. Due to that it can't render the per-guest apparmor rules correctly for this extra device. In a similar fashion bug 1775777 had issues with late additions of vfio devices.
